Castillo lifts Kailua over Roosevelt


  

Wed, Jan 10, 2018 @ Kailua


Final 1st 2nd OT 2OT PK Tot
Roosevelt (5-4-2) 0 0 - - - 0
Kailua (5-6-0) 1 0 - - - 1




Ralph Castillo accounted for the only score of the game in Kailua's 1-0 win over Roosevelt in an Oahu Interscholastic Association Eastern Division match at Alex Kane Stadium Wednesday night.

Castillo scored off a free kick just before the end of the first half to help the Surfriders improve to 4-3 in the league standings.

The Rough Riders dropped to 4-2-1 with the loss.
